2024
The Last Podcast as Charlie Bailey
2020
What We Found as Justin Weingarter
2018
A BuzzFeed Holiday Special: Live! as Self
2018
Dead Sound as Topper
2016
High Maintenance (1 episode)
2015
The Girl in the Book as Boy
2015
Pipe Dream as Peter Epstein-Takahashi
2010
Blue Bloods as Charles Hayes (1 episode)
1999
Law & Order: Special Victims Unit as Vincent Drago (1 episode)